Public Relations Coordinator Salary in New York

How much does a Public Relations Coordinator make in New York?

As of August 01, 2026, the average salary for a Public Relations Coordinator in New York is $81,574 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$39.

However, a Public Relations Coordinator's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$99,058
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$75,139 to $90,726
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$69,280

How Experience Level Affects Public Relations Coordinator Salaries?

Experience is a primary driver of a Public Relations Coordinator's salary. As you build your skills and take on more complex tasks, your compensation generally increases. Here’s how the average salary grows at different career stages:

  • Entry-Level (less than 1 year): $65,439
  • Early Career (1-2 years): $80,901
  • Mid-Level (2-4 years): $101,589
  • Senior-Level (5-8 years): $126,623
  • Expert (over 8 years): $142,969

Public Relations Coordinator Salary by Industry: Top Paying Sectors

For Public Relations Coordinator roles, the industry you choose can affect earning potential by as much as 80% (the gap between the highest and lowest paying industries). Data shows that the MFG Nondurable and Energy & Utilities sectors offer the strongest compensation, at 40% above the average. In contrast, Public Relations Coordinator positions in Pharmaceuticals or Financial Services typically offer lower base pay, as these industries often view Public Relations Coordinator as a support function rather than a direct revenue driver.
